Kea DHCP سرور BIND 10 تي ٻڌل آهي ۽ ٺهيل هڪ ماڊلر فن تعمير کي استعمال ڪندي، جنهن جو مطلب آهي تقسيم ڪارڪردگي کي مختلف پروسيسر پروسيس ۾. پراڊڪٽ ۾ شامل آهي مڪمل خصوصيت وارو سرور عمل درآمد DHCPv4 ۽ DHCPv6 پروٽوڪول جي سپورٽ سان، ISC DHCP کي تبديل ڪرڻ جي قابل. Kea ۾ ڊي اين ايس زونز (متحرڪ DNS) کي متحرڪ طور تي تازه ڪاري ڪرڻ لاءِ ٺهيل اوزار آهن، سرور جي ڳولا، ايڊريس اسائنمينٽ، تازه ڪاري ۽ ٻيهر ڪنيڪشن، خدمت جي معلومات جي درخواستن، ميزبانن لاءِ ايڊريس محفوظ ڪرڻ، ۽ PXE بوٽنگ لاءِ ميڪانيزم کي سپورٽ ڪري ٿو. DHCPv6 عمل درآمد اضافي طور تي اڳوڻن کي نمائندگي ڪرڻ جي صلاحيت فراهم ڪري ٿو. هڪ خاص API مهيا ڪئي وئي آهي ٻاهرين ايپليڪيشنن سان رابطو ڪرڻ لاءِ. اهو ممڪن آهي ته سرور کي ٻيهر شروع ڪرڻ کان سواء اڏام تي ترتيب تازه ڪاري ڪرڻ.
مختص ڪيل ايڊريس ۽ ڪلائنٽ پيٽرولر بابت معلومات مختلف قسم جي اسٽوريج ۾ محفوظ ڪري سگھجي ٿي - في الحال CSV فائلن، MySQL DBMS، Apache Cassandra ۽ PostgreSQL ۾ اسٽوريج لاءِ پس منظر مهيا ڪيا ويا آهن. ميزبان رزرويشن پيٽرولر JSON فارميٽ ۾ ترتيب ڏيڻ واري فائل ۾ يا MySQL ۽ PostgreSQL ۾ ٽيبل جي طور تي بيان ڪري سگھجي ٿو. ھن ۾ شامل آھي perfdhcp اوزار DHCP سرور جي ڪارڪردگي کي ماپڻ ۽ انگ اکر گڏ ڪرڻ لاءِ اجزاء. Kea سٺي ڪارڪردگي ڏيکاري ٿو، مثال طور، جڏهن MySQL پس منظر استعمال ڪري ٿو، سرور انجام ڏئي سگھي ٿو 1000 ايڊريس اسائنمينٽ في سيڪنڊ (اٽڪل 4000 پيڪٽس في سيڪنڊ)، ۽ جڏهن ميم فائل پس منظر استعمال ڪندي، ڪارڪردگي 7500 اسائنمنٽس في سيڪنڊ تائين پهچي ٿي.
ھڪڙي ترتيب واري پس منظر (سي بي، ترتيب واري پس منظر) تي عمل ڪيو ويو آھي، توھان کي مرڪزي طور تي ڪيترن ئي DHCPv4 ۽ DHCPv6 سرورن جي سيٽنگن کي منظم ڪرڻ جي اجازت ڏئي ٿو. پس منظر تمام گهڻيون ڪي سيٽنگون ذخيرو ڪرڻ لاءِ استعمال ڪري سگھجن ٿيون، بشمول گلوبل سيٽنگون، شيئر نيٽ ورڪ، سبنيٽس، آپشنز، پول، ۽ آپشن وصفون. اهي سڀئي سيٽنگون مقامي ترتيب واري فائل ۾ محفوظ ڪرڻ جي بدران، اهي هاڻي هڪ خارجي ڊيٽابيس ۾ رکيل آهن. انهي حالت ۾، اهو ممڪن آهي ته سڀ ڪجهه نه، پر سي بي جي ذريعي ڪجهه سيٽنگون، خارجي ڊيٽابيس ۽ مقامي ترتيبن جي فائلن مان اوورلينگ پيٽرولر (مثال طور، نيٽ ورڪ انٽرفيس سيٽنگون مقامي فائلن ۾ ڇڏي سگھجن ٿيون).
DBMSs مان اسٽوريج ترتيب ڏيڻ لاءِ، صرف MySQL هن وقت سپورٽ ٿيل آهي (MySQL، PostgreSQL ۽ Cassandra ايڊريس اسائنمينٽ ڊيٽابيس (ليز) کي ذخيرو ڪرڻ لاءِ استعمال ڪري سگهجن ٿا، ۽ MySQL ۽ PostgreSQL ميزبانن کي محفوظ ڪرڻ لاءِ استعمال ٿي سگهن ٿا). ڊيٽابيس ۾ ٺاھ جوڙ کي تبديل ڪري سگھجي ٿو يا ته DBMS تائين سڌو رسائي ذريعي يا خاص طور تي تيار ڪيل پرت لائبريرين جي ذريعي جيڪا ترتيب ڏيڻ جي انتظام لاءِ ڪمانڊ جو ھڪ معياري سيٽ مهيا ڪري ٿي، جھڙوڪ شامل ڪرڻ ۽ ختم ڪرڻ پيرا ميٽرز، بائنڊنگز، DHCP آپشنز ۽ سبنيٽس؛
شامل ڪيو ويو هڪ نئون ”ڊراپ“ هينڊلر ڪلاس (ڊراپ ڪلاس سان لاڳاپيل سڀئي پيڪيٽ فوري طور تي ڊاهيا ويندا آهن)، جيڪي استعمال ڪري سگھجن ٿا اڻ وڻندڙ ٽريفڪ ڇڏڻ لاءِ، مثال طور، خاص قسم جا DHCP پيغام؛
نون پيرا ميٽرز وڌ ۾ وڌ-ليز-وقت ۽ منٽ-ليز-وقت شامل ڪيا ويا آھن، توھان کي اجازت ڏئي ٿو ته ايڊريس جي زندگي جي مدت جو تعين ڪرڻ لاءِ ڪلائنٽ (ليز) کي پابند ڪرڻ جي صورت ۾ نه، پر سخت ڪوڊ ٿيل قدر جي صورت ۾. قابل قبول حد؛
ڊوائيسز سان بهتر مطابقت جيڪي مڪمل طور تي DHCP معيار سان عمل نٿا ڪن. مسئلن جي چوڌاري ڪم ڪرڻ لاءِ، Kea ھاڻي موڪلي ٿو DHCPv4 پيغام جي قسم جي معلومات آپشن لسٽ جي بلڪل شروعات ۾، ھوسٽ نالن جي مختلف نمائندگي کي سنڀاليندو آھي، ھڪڙي خالي ميزبان نالي جي منتقلي کي سڃاڻي ٿو، ۽ ذيلي اختياري ڪوڊ 0 کان 255 تائين بيان ڪرڻ جي اجازت ڏئي ٿو؛